Transaction 73abb31ac09c9760097de8c36340ae066243a251012a366864fa43419a803723
1 Input
1 Output
-
73abb31ac09c9760097de8c36340ae066243a251012a366864fa43419a803723:0
- value
- 1212003
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ba320d9d9da7ab3f23e9efbe8a308d902ea7711
- address
- bc1qnw3jpkwemfat8u37nma73gcgmypw5ac3727vdz